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 19 -- United States Patent no. 12,330,235, issued on June 17, was assigned to Corelase Oy (Tampere, Finland).
"Laser welding of metal pin pairs with time-dependent scan pattern and energy input" was invented by Peter Kallage (Hamburg, Germany), Oliver Forster (Guster, Germany), Oliver Kraus (Jork, Germany), Falk Nagel (Bad Oldesloe, Germany) and Stefan Schulz (Guster, Germany).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A method for laser welding a pair of metal pins delivers a laser beam to a work-side of the pair of metal pins where a respective pair of surfaces of the metal pins are adjacent to each other and face in the same direction.
